The Benefits of Family Laughter
- Stress Relief: Laughter is a natural stress reliever that can help family members unwind and relax. In the midst of busy schedules and daily challenges, sharing a laugh can provide much-needed relief and create a positive atmosphere at home.
- Improved Communication: Humor can break down barriers and facilitate open communication within families. When family members laugh together, they are more likely to engage in meaningful conversations and express their thoughts and feelings more freely.
- Enhanced Bonding: Shared laughter creates a sense of unity and togetherness among family members. When you share funny moments and inside jokes, you create lasting memories that strengthen your bond and create a sense of belonging.
- Boosted Mood: Laughter releases endorphins, the body's natural feel-good chemicals, which can elevate mood and increase overall happiness. By laughing together as a family, you can create a positive and uplifting environment in your home.
- Conflict Resolution: Humor can defuse tension and help resolve conflicts in a more lighthearted manner. When families learn to laugh together, they develop resilience and the ability to overcome challenges with a positive outlook.
Cultivating Family Laughter
Now that you understand the benefits of family laughter, you may be wondering how to incorporate more humor into your daily routine. Here are some tips to help you cultivate a culture of laughter within your family:
- Watch Comedy Shows or Movies Together: Gather your family for a movie night featuring a comedy that will have everyone laughing out loud.
- Share Funny Stories and Jokes: Encourage family members to share jokes, funny anecdotes, or embarrassing moments to lighten the mood and spark laughter.
- Play Silly Games: Organize game nights with silly or playful games that will bring out the laughter in everyone.
- Create Humorous Traditions: Establish traditions that involve humor, such as telling a joke at the dinner table or sharing a funny meme each day.
- Embrace Spontaneity: Allow room for spontaneity and silliness in your interactions with family members to keep things light and enjoyable.
